Common Issues

Many budget foot massagers suffer from weak vibration motors that lose intensity over time, uneven heat distribution creating hot spots, or flimsy construction that cracks under foot pressure. The 'travel' claim often conflicts with bulky designs or non-universal power adapters.

Quality Indicators

Look for products with detailed descriptions of massage techniques (not just 'vibration modes'), verified heat range specifications (ideally 95-130°F), and construction materials that withstand repeated compression. Genuine reviews mentioning months of use without degradation are more valuable than initial impressions.

How We Detect Fake Reviews

Our AI analyzes multiple factors: language patterns (generic vs. specific), reviewer behavior (history, timing), temporal anomalies (review clusters), verification status, sentiment authenticity, and statistical outliers. No single factor determines a review is fake - we look at the combination of signals.

Important Limitations

No automated system is perfect. Sophisticated fake reviews can evade detection, and some genuine reviews may be incorrectly flagged. Use this analysis as one data point in your purchasing decision, not the only factor. Reading actual review content yourself is always valuable.
